Gary will provide rods and reels, as well as waders and instruction for beginners.
These waters are home to Catfish, Sunfish, Walleye, Carp, Smallmouth Bass, Largemouth Bass, Trout, Shad, Striped Bass, and more, depending on the season.
You’re welcome to bring a group as large as 12 on this guided fly-fishing experience. You’ll be fishing from the shore, so expect to make your way on foot at least part of the time and come dressed for current weather conditions.
